This series aims to add some improvements to existing ram
driver decicated to stm32 SoCs :
_ some code clean up
_ full DT support, now the FMC base is retrieved through DT
_ update DT API by using ofnode_read...() or dev_read..() instead
of fdtdec_get..() to support livetree
_ add second SDRAM bank support needed for STM32H7-Discovery board
which uses the second SDRAM bank
_ add stm32 H7 support

Retrieve RAM base address from DT instead of using STM32_SDRAM_FMC
For STM32F7, FMC block base address is 0xA0000000, but SDRAM
registers are located at offset 0x140 inside FMC block.
Update the stm32_fmc_regs fields with all FMC registers
to map SDRAM registers at the right address.
These additionals registers will be used later.

FMC is able to manage 2 SDRAM banks, but the current driver
implementation is only able to manage the first SDRAM bank.
Even if only bank2 is used, some bank1 registers must be
configured.

STM32F7 and H7 shared the same SDRAM control block.
On STM32H7 few control bits has been added.
The current driver need some minor adaptation as FMC block
enable/disable for H7.
